Physical Exam Techniques Palpation & Percussion Palpation is another physical exam technique you will use in your focused endocrine assessment. During light palpation, compress the skin about ½ inch to 3/4 inch with the pads of your fingers. When using deep palpation, use your finger pads and compress the skin about 1½ inches to 2 inches.
